Summary

Amidst the sweltering summer of 1917 in Brookhaven, Mabel Roberts embodies the resilient spirit of her ancestors, laboring as a sharecropper on the Langston plantation. With a legacy steeped in struggle and sacrifice, she navigates the earth’s rich history, guided by her mother’s wisdom. As familial bonds intertwine and dreams are sown, Mabel discovers the untold stories that compel her grandson Leo to reimagine their future.

About the Author

Anthony Kevin Pete

Anthony Kevin Pete

Anthony Kevin Pete is a poet, author, and storyteller from Port Arthur, Texas. He specializes in free-verse poetry, drawing inspiration from personal experiences and life lessons. His work often reflects themes of blessings and resilience.
